About the Organisation

We are recruiting on behalf of a leading public healthcare network in Singapore, delivering integrated care across acute hospitals, specialist centres, and community services. This network operates one of Singapore’s newest integrated hospitals, designed to provide seamless, patient-centred care across acute, rehabilitative, and community settings. With modern infrastructure and ongoing expansion, it offers an excellent platform for clinical leadership and service development.

About the Role

The Department of Laboratory Medicine and Pathology is seeking a Consultant Microbiologist to provide clinical leadership within Medical Microbiology. This is a unique opportunity to contribute to the development of microbiology services within a modern healthcare facility, including involvement in workflow optimisation, quality systems, and future laboratory automation initiatives. You will work closely with multidisciplinary teams to support infection management, diagnostics, and patient safety across the hospital.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ide clinical and laboratory oversight of microbiology services
  • Lead development of laboratory protocols, workflows, and quality systems
  • Support laboratory accreditation and continuous quality improvement
  • Participate in Infection Prevention & Control (IPC) and Antimicrobial Stewardship (AMS) programmes
  • Provide specialist microbiology advice to clinicians and hospital teams
  • Contribute to education, training, and supervision of junior staff
  • Participate in research, audit, and service development initiatives

Candidate Requirements

  • MBBS or equivalent medical degree
  • Specialist qualification in Microbiology / Pathology (FRCPath, FRCPA or equivalent)
  • Eligible for Specialist Registration with the Singapore Medical Council (SMC)
  • Minimum 3 years’ post-specialist experience
  • Experience in clinical microbiology and laboratory leadership
